Medoo初始化及数据库配置方法

数据库评论891字数 1158阅读3分51秒

关于数据库的配置方法,官方给的是独立配置,就是在每个调用页面都写一个配置文件,这样太麻烦了,类似这样的

require  'medoo.php';
$database = new medoo([
    'database_type' => 'mysql',
    'database_name' => 'name',
    'server' => 'localhost',
    'username' => 'your_username',
    'password' => 'your_password',
    //可选
    'port' => 3306,
    'charset' => 'utf8',
    'prefix' => 'PREFIX_',//数据表前缀
    'logging' => true,//日志
    // DB连接驱动选项
    'option' => [
        PDO::ATTR_CASE => PDO::CASE_NATURAL
    ]]);
//下面是业务代码
$database->insert("account", [
    "user_name" => "foo",
    "email" => "foo@bar.com"]);

这里推荐一个引用的方法把

数据库配置文件方法

在medoo文件夹下面新建config.php文件(名字自取),在config.php文件中写入以下代码:

require 'Medoo.php';
// 实例化medoo
use MedooMedoo;
$database = new medoo([
  'database_type' => 'mysql',
  'database_name' => '数据库名称',
  'server' => '数据库主机地址',
  'username' => '数据库用户名',
  'password' => '数据库密码',
  'charset' => 'utf8'
]);

在需要使用medoo的地方引入

require 'config.php';
//下面是业务代码
$datas = $database->select("dede_addonimages", [
    "aid",
    "taobaoid"
]);
var_dump($datas);

官方配置手册文章源自国强极客生活-https://tagqwl.com/4757.html

文章源自国强极客生活-https://tagqwl.com/4757.html文章源自国强极客生活-https://tagqwl.com/4757.html
weinxin
我的微信
添加我的微信,有任何问题请与我直接联系(备注:国强极客生活)
  • 全部本人精心整理制作,希望大家多多支持。
  • 转载请务必保留本文链接:https://tagqwl.com/4757.html
匿名

发表评论

匿名网友 填写信息

:?: :razz: :sad: :evil: :!: :smile: :oops: :grin: :eek: :shock: :???: :cool: :lol: :mad: :twisted: :roll: :wink: :idea: :arrow: :neutral: :cry: :mrgreen: